Klopp Has Bad News For Man Utd Ahead of Liverpool Visit

By Daily Sports on October 19, 2019

Manchester United “will have to wait a week” if they want to change their season, says Jurgen Klopp.

Klopp’s Liverpool travel to Old Trafford on Sunday eight points clear at the top of the Premier League and 15 points ahead of 12th-placed United.

United manager Ole Gunnar Solskjaer said it is the “perfect game” to motivate his struggling side.

Klopp said: “I don’t think there are a lot of teams who would love to play against us at the moment.”

The German added: “It looks like Manchester United is the only team that wants to play us, and we have to make sure that is a misunderstanding.

“I would do the same if the situation was the other way around. This is the game [where] we can change the world; that is the way I would prepare [for] it.

“They are in a situation that they don't like and they want to change it. We just have to make sure that if they want to change it, they start a week later and that’s all.” (BBC)
